The Invesco BulletShares 2029 High Yield Corporate Bond ETF seeks to replicate the performance of the Invesco BulletShares High Yield Corporate Bond 2029 Index. This fund invests a minimum of 80% of its total assets in corporate bonds that are part of the index. The index itself tracks a basket of US dollar-denominated, high-yield corporate bonds, all of which share an effective maturity date in 2029. To achieve its investment goal, the fund utilizes a "sampling" approach rather than acquiring every security within the index. Both the fund and its benchmark index undergo monthly rebalancing.
